The global economy is from an airline industry perspective picking up slowly, we have seen a slight recovery of the overall Dutch travel market in March 2010, but we are still far from the levels of previous years. This has had an impact not only on SAS, but on all airlines flying to and from the Netherlands. From a globally perspective the low point in the cycle was according to the official IATA statistics in February 2009, and since then the International passenger traffic has picked up 8.6 % year to date. In this light it should be noted that the market has not yet recovered from the losses of 2008 and early 2009. Demand must improve by a further 2 % to return to the peak levels of early 2008. Lucas Joel, Honorary Consul of Sweden for the Northern Netherlands, Nordconnect, and Energy Valley foundation, are very pleased to invite Swedish public and private parties, active in the Energy sector, to visit the Northern Netherlands on the 6th and 7th of May 2010. The Northern Netherlands provinces have a strong energy sector with 400 companies, 25,000 jobs and 350 development projects (both public and private). Together they form the Energy Valley region. There is a strong focus on the development of sustainable mobility, energy, clean fossil energy and new energy technologies. Therefore the Energy Valley region is leading in the development of a sustainable energy economy.

JCC Up-coming Program April 15, 2010 The presentation of Handelsbanken will tell you how the bank is operating in today’s economical environment without bonuses, organisation diagrams or budgets. The banks extremely decentralised way of working has resulted in better profitability than the peers for the last 38 years running; the most satisfied customers ever since the first independent surveys were carried out 18 years ago and the lowest costs and loan losses off all major European banks for decades.
